A Guide to Choosing a Dress Code for Celebration of Life

The liberty to step out of the dark-colored dress code of a traditional funeral is one of the reasons people choose cremation services like a celebration of life in Phoenix, AZ. But the freedom of a celebration of life comes with things to consider when deciding the dress code for the event. This article explains the most important factors to guide your decision.

Location of the ceremony

A significant advantage of having a celebration of life is that families can hold it anywhere. This means they are more likely to happen in informal venues like a restaurant, beach, or even someone’s home. Generally, somewhere meaningful to the deceased or the surviving family. Hence, when deciding on a dress code for your guests, it’s vital to consider what’s most comfortable for the location. If it’s outdoors, comfy footwear is necessary (flat shoes, sandals, etc.), and you may want to avoid light colors that can quickly get dirty.

Time of the day

Another thing, a celebration of life can occur at any time: dawn, afternoon, or late at night. There are no rules, but that doesn’t mean all kinds of clothes are suitable for all times of the day. If the event is happening at night when it’s more likely to be cold, your dress code should include coats, jackets, and sweaters—anything to make your guests feel warmer. In the afternoon with warmer weather? Breathable clothing options are better. You may also want to recommend protective accessories like sunglasses and sunscreen if there are outdoor activities.

Scheduled activities

What’s the plan? A celebration of life usually consists of activities meant to honor the deceased. It can be anything from a hike to a cozy night of watching your loved one’s favorite movies. Knowing what you intend to do at the ceremony should inform the right clothes for guests to wear. Say you are having a hike and a dinner after, then your dress code recommendations should include sneakers, light clothing, and dinner clothes. You should also consider the type of dinner. Will it be formal or a casual get-together around the table? Both are fine, but the dress choices are different.

The tone of the event

Finally, tone. There are no rules to a celebration of life events, meaning families can decide to mix up the mood or stick to the joyous atmosphere commonly associated with the service. Say some family members want a sober, traditional funeral-style event in the morning and a celebration at night. Your guests, especially those who can’t afford to go back for a change of clothes, may have to pack formal dresses for the morning service and informal clothes for evening activities. In practice, this can be dark, colored suits in the morning and breezy t-shirts and jeans at night. Or a costume if you want a themed event.

Ensuring your guests are comfortable is essential to having a successful event. And while creating a proper dress code for a celebration of life may not be straightforward, it is worth the effort.
